Querciabella Mongrana is a vibrant red wine from the Maremma Toscana DOC appellation, first produced in 2005. This organic and vegan-certified wine is a blend of Sangiovese, Cabernet Sauvignon, and Merlot grapes, cultivated using plant-based biodynamic practices. The vineyards, established in 2000, span 33 hectares near the Uccellina Natural Park's highlands, benefiting from proximity to the sea and unspoiled nature. Mongrana undergoes fermentation in cement and stainless steel vats, followed by 12 months of aging, resulting in a wine with an alcohol content of 13.5% vol. With an annual production of 120,000 bottles, it offers a harmonious balance of fruit and freshness, making it versatile for various pairings.
